JetBrains invited me to their annual JavaScript Day to talk about - what else - modern JavaScript tooling.
In this session I showed how the shift towards Rust-powered tools (Vite with Rolldown, Oxc, Oxlint) translates into concrete wins for day-to-day development: faster builds, quicker feedback cycles and fewer of the usual papercuts that come with maintaining JavaScript projects over time.
